Cau dobry tool urcite vyzkousim, ale dopadlo to jak jsem si myslel. Taky kdyz programuju s chat gpt tak si obcas dela co chce. Usetris cas na delani nejake obecne kostry programu, pak nejake konkretnejsi veci si radsi napisu sam, pro me rychlejsi nez vymyslet prompt aby to AI pochopila co presne chcu
@davidstrejc3 ай бұрын
Super - presne o tom bude dalsi lekce rekneme. Nebo jedna z dalsich. "Psat rucne nic nechces" ver mi. I kdyz beres AI "jen jako psaci stroj" - musis myslet "do budoucna" - protoze za 1 rok uz to bude absolutne na jinem levelu. A o tom celem tu bude par lekci a videji.
@robwiz93 ай бұрын
Programování s AI je fajn, bohužel když sám nestrávíš ten čas vymýšlením svých algoritmů, tak programátor skončí na tom, že ani nebude vědět, kde a že je někde potenciální chyba či zranitelnost. Nebráním se použití AI když potřebuju přijít na řešení části problému, nějaká lambda funkce, list comprehension, dlouhá dokumentace atd., ovšem generováním celého kódu si snižuješ do budoucna možnosti, jak v něm chyby hledat. A pro opravení té chyby tak, jak chceš, se s tím kódem stejně musíš seznámit, čímž ztrácíš časovou výhodu, kterou ti generování poskytne. Ostříleného programátora, jako tebe, hned z kraje napadne chyba, kterou jsi vysvětloval, že se Monstrum spawne přímo na Snake, čímž logicky ukončí hru. Jiný, neosvícený člověk by ale AI nakrmil promptem "Ono to nefunguje", protože kódu a vlastně ani programování vůbec nerozumí. Určitě bych tuhle sérii nepropagoval jako Ez programming tutorial 101, jak vyplývá z názvu, protože prompt engineering prostě nemá s programováním nic společného. Ale jinak zajímavé video 👍
@davidstrejc3 ай бұрын
Na všechno je odpověď prompting. A dobře, že píšete commenty. Všechno si vysvětlíme v dalších lekcích. Ono totiž není vůbec problém napsat "ono to nefunguje". I naprostý junior může díky debug logům "přijít na to, proč to nefunguje" - a pochybuju, že naprostý junior bude vědět, jak naprogramovat hada. Klasické programování končí a na security je tu SonarQube a podobné tooly. Celkově celé programovací flow budou dělat boti. GPT5 má být inteligencí na úrovni PhD.
@robwiz92 ай бұрын
@@davidstrejc Dobře. Když to teda má být strašně chytré a všichni to budou používat, co tedy bude podle tebe rozhodující faktor při pohovorech, zda člověka vezmou, nebo ne, když programovat bude umět stejně dobře člověk, co na to kouká poprvé a ty, co se v oboru už nějakou tu dobu, cituji tvývch 20 let v komerčním IT. Proč si myslíš, že jsi pro firmy cennější než mladý, co vylez z výšky, když oba "umíte programovat" stejně dobře?
@davidstrejc2 ай бұрын
@@robwiz9 Jedine, co se bude cenit, je "hackerstvi" - to znamena, jak clovek pristupuje k reseni problemu - a ano 20 let delam IT ve firmach a od 4 sedim u compu. IT neni o programovani ale o procesech. O workflows, procesech, znalosti vseho okolo od hardwaru az po to, jak uzivatel klika v tescu na kasu. To se da naucit pouze casem. Ale v soucasnosti se to da konzultovat s AIckem, ktere docela dobre poradi.A velmi pravdepodobne timto tempem stejne dojde "k prerodu spolecnosti". Znovu opakuju - GPT 5 je uroven PhD. Uz je v treninku pravdepodobne GPT 6 nebo Claude 4 a 5 - tam uz je ten level uplne nekde jinde. Staci si precist o tom, ze M$ dela cluster za 100 miliard dolaru. Staci studovat, co se ve svete AI deje.
3 ай бұрын
Tady si někdo popletl programování s promptováním, ne? 🙂
@davidstrejc3 ай бұрын
Programování jako takové končí. Jaký je rozdíl mezi assamblerem a AI promptem z pohledu programovacího jazyka? Obojí jsou instrukce pro mašinu, "co má dělat". Programování znamená "z mašiny dostat očekávaný výsledek". A je jedno, jestli to dostanu z Assembly nebo jestli to ve finále udělá AIcko.
3 ай бұрын
@@davidstrejc To snad nemyslíš vážně, že programování jako takové končí, že ne? S takovým argumentem doufám, že se tohle dostane k co nejméně nováčkům, kteří se chtějí do světa programování dostat a seriozně tam tvořit hodnoty.
@davidstrejc3 ай бұрын
Cim mas podlozenu domenku, ze psani kodu jako takoveho nekocni? Uvedomujes si ze gpt5 level je PhD. Cetl jsi o startupu z FR ktery prepise WP za 3 hodiny? Vis co jsou to agentske flow?
@davidstrejc3 ай бұрын
Vyzyvam te na coding challenge. Ty pojedes ciste bez AIcek ve tvem oblibenem jazyce, prostredi a se vsim co znas vcetne frameworku a cehokoli. Ja ciste aider bez vimu jen s lazygitem. Muzes jit i do pascalu, cobolu nebo ceho chces.
@davidstrejc3 ай бұрын
www.businesswire.com/news/home/20240613668421/en/Shreds.AI-Launches-the-First-AI-Capable-of-Generating-Complex-Software Doporucuju precist a pochopit, ze to porad neni ani gpt5 a to se petka ma podle spoluzakladatele openai zamerovat na programovani.